            Other topics discussed by the Committee include developments in the legislative and

            executive framework for regulating and protecting competition in the UAE. Emphasis was
            placed on the importance of organizing workshops and seminars in collaboration with

            relevant local entities to raise awareness on the importance of enforcing competition laws

            and policies across various economic sectors and preventing monopolistic practices.

            These efforts are aimed at achieving economic balance in the market and protecting
            consumer rights.
